Abfrage welche User sich auf welchen Geräten angemeldet haben
Moin,
gibt es eine Möglichkeit, im Idealfall per Powershell, abzufragen welcher User sich auf welchem Gerät angemeldet hat?
Ich habe eine Anfrage von einem Kunden der wissen möchte, anhand eine Liste mit Usern und einer bestimmten Berechtigungsgruppe (für den WLan Zugriff), ob diese User überhaupt Laptops benutzen und damit auch Zugriff auf das WLan benötigen.
Wäre über einen Lösungsansatz sehr dankbar.
Grüße,
Oerdoerd
gibt es eine Möglichkeit, im Idealfall per Powershell, abzufragen welcher User sich auf welchem Gerät angemeldet hat?
Ich habe eine Anfrage von einem Kunden der wissen möchte, anhand eine Liste mit Usern und einer bestimmten Berechtigungsgruppe (für den WLan Zugriff), ob diese User überhaupt Laptops benutzen und damit auch Zugriff auf das WLan benötigen.
Wäre über einen Lösungsansatz sehr dankbar.
Grüße,
Oerdoerd
Bitte markiere auch die Kommentare, die zur Lösung des Beitrags beigetragen haben
Content-ID: 363757
Url: https://administrator.de/contentid/363757
Ausgedruckt am: 22.11.2024 um 02:11 Uhr
3 Kommentare
Neuester Kommentar
Moin,
Stichworte:
- Get-ADGroupMember
- Get-Computerinfo (für Rechnertyp)
- ProfileImagePath (jemals alle angemeldeten Benutzer aus der Registry auslesen)
Das Ganze in eine Schleife packen und die Benutzer einem Rechnertyp zuordnen.
Am Ende hast du dann deine Zuordnung wer aus der Gruppe einen Laptop benutzt und WLAN Zugriff benötigt.
VG
Stichworte:
- Get-ADGroupMember
- Get-Computerinfo (für Rechnertyp)
- ProfileImagePath (jemals alle angemeldeten Benutzer aus der Registry auslesen)
Das Ganze in eine Schleife packen und die Benutzer einem Rechnertyp zuordnen.
Am Ende hast du dann deine Zuordnung wer aus der Gruppe einen Laptop benutzt und WLAN Zugriff benötigt.
VG
Guten morgen,
Deine Abfrage für die Mitglieder einer AD Gruppe, inklusive Export in eine .csv Datei, sollte so aussehen:
Mit der folgenden Abfrage kannst du dir die Benutzer aus der Registry auslesen und SIDs direkt übersetzen lassen:
Ist denn ersichtlich, durch den Namen oder eine Gruppe, welche Geräte die Notebooks sind oder musst du das auch noch über eine Abfrage regeln?
Gruß
Deine Abfrage für die Mitglieder einer AD Gruppe, inklusive Export in eine .csv Datei, sollte so aussehen:
Get-ADGroupMember -identity “Gruppe” -recursive | select name | Export-csv -path Pfadangabe\Dateiname.csv -NoTypeInformation
Mit der folgenden Abfrage kannst du dir die Benutzer aus der Registry auslesen und SIDs direkt übersetzen lassen:
Get-ChildItem -Path "HKLM:\SOFTWARE\Microsoft\Windows NT\CurrentVersion\ProfileList" | ForEach-Object{
$objSID = New-Object System.Security.Principal.SecurityIdentifier($($_.Name| split-path -leaf))
$objUser = $objSID.Translate( [System.Security.Principal.NTAccount])
$objUser.Value
}
Ist denn ersichtlich, durch den Namen oder eine Gruppe, welche Geräte die Notebooks sind oder musst du das auch noch über eine Abfrage regeln?
Gruß